Rains flood Lahore: Punjab police, traffic wardens lauded for proactive performance

Regardless of the flooded roads, the traffic wardens and Punjab police performed their duty with full devotion

Lahore (Pakistan Point News – 4th July, 2018) A flood-like situation was developed in Lahore following the heavy rain and thunderstorm the city received on Tuesday.

An emergency alert was also issued in Lahore in view of the heavy rains. Water is still accumulated on some of the roads of the city while a part of an under construction road in front of GPO Chowk, Mall Road submerged into the ground.

However, what came into attention was the performance of Punjab Police and traffic wardens on the flooded roads of the city. A video of the traffic wardens went viral on social media where they are performing their duty while standing in accumulated rain water.

Regardless of the flooded roads, the traffic wardens performed their duty with full devotion. In the video, one of the traffic warden is seen disposing off the rain water.

The social media users lauded the efforts of this traffic warden.

Meanwhile, a picture of Punjab Police officials has also gone viral on social media who are removing the trees fallen on the roads.

At least six people were killed and 16 others suffered injuries in rain-related incidents in different areas of provincial capital on Tuesday. A spokesman of Rescue 1122 said that four persons were electrocuted while two others were in killed in a building collapse incident.

However, all the departments proactively worked for disposal of water while work is underway to fill the crater at GPO Chowk.
